1Protective effects of Buyinqianzheng Formula on mitochondrial morphology by PINK1/Parkin pathway in SH-SY5Y cells induced by MPP^(+)显示文摘Objective:Buyinqianzheng Formula(BYQZF)is clinically employed in traditional Chinese medicine to treat Parkinson's disease(PD)by improving mitochondrial dysfunction.However,the underlying mechanisms by which BYQZF affects mitochondrial morphology remain unknown.Therefore,we observed the effects of BYQZF on mitochondria from the perspective of the PINK1/Parkin pathway.Methods:Cell survival rates were assessed by Cell Counting Kit-8 assay.Expression levels of PINK1 and Parkin mRNA were examined by qRT-PCR.Protein expression levels of PINK1,PINK1-Ser228,Parkin,Parkin-Ser65,Drp1,and Drp1-Ser637 were examined by western blotting.PINK1,Parkin,and MitoTracker?Red CMXRos(MTR)were stained by triple-labeled immunofluorescence,and observed under laser confocal microscopy.Results:Cell survival rate,mitochondrial form factor,mean length and number of mitochondrial network branches,mitochondrial activity,m RNA expression levels of PINK1 and Parkin,and protein expression levels of PINK1,Parkin,and Drp1-Ser637 were reduced after 1-methyl-4-phenylpyridinium(MPP^(+))intervention.In contrast,Pearson's correlation coefficients between PINK1 and Parkin,and between Parkin and MTR,as well as protein expression levels of PINK1-Ser228,Parkin-Ser65,and Drp1 increased significantly after MPP^(+) intervention.Treatment with BYQZF increased cell survival rate,mitochondrial form factor,mean length and number of mitochondrial network branches,mitochondrial activity,m RNA expression levels of PINK1 and Parkin,and expression of PINK1,Parkin,and Drp1-Ser637 proteins.Pearson's correlation coefficients between PINK1 and Parkin,and between Parkin and MTR,as well as protein expression levels of PINK1-Ser228,Parkin-Ser65,and Drp1 decreased after BYQZF treatment.Conclusion:These results demonstrate that BYQZF has a protective effect on mitochondrial molecular mechanisms in the PD cell model,and the mechanism is related to the PINK1/Parkin pathway.Haojie Ma Zhenyu Guo Cong Gai Cuicui Cheng Jinkun Zhang Yuxin Zhang Luping Yang Wandi Feng Yushan Gao Hongmei Sun 2020Journal of Traditional Chinese Medical Sciences2020,7,3:3

3Mechanism of mitochondrial protection by the Buyin Qianzheng formula in a Parkin overexpression cell model显示文摘Objective:To identify the molecular mechanisms of the effects of the Buyin Qianzheng formula(BYQZF)on the mitochondrial dynamics in a Parkin overexpression Parkinson's disease(PD)cell model.Methods:First,a stable Parkin overexpression cell model was constructed using plasmid transfection.Then,we examined the protective effect of BYQZF on the mitochondrial dysfunction of the Parkin overexpression PD cell model induced by neurotoxin 1-methyl-4-phenylpyridinium ion(MPPþ).The mRNA expression level of Parkin was evaluated using real-time quantitative PCR.The cell survival rate was detected using the Cell Counting Kit-8 assay.We evaluated the cellular adenosine triphosphate(ATP)levels using luciferase assays.A laser scanning confocal microscope was used to observe the mitochondrial morphology,activity,and mitochondrial membrane potential(DJm).Western blot was conducted to evaluate the levels of the fusion proteins mitofusin1,mitofusin2,optic atrophy 1,dynaminrelated protein 1,and mitochondrial fission protein 1.Results:Parkin overexpression attenuated MPPþ-induced mitochondrial damage,increased mitochondrial activity and DJm.BYQZF increased the survival of MPPþ-induced cells that overexpressed Parkin and upregulated the mitochondrial form factor and activity.It also inhibited a decrease in the DJm and ATP levels.These findings suggested that BYQZF protected against MPPþ-induced mitochondrial dysfunction and enhanced the protective effect of Parkin overexpression.Furthermore,the formula upregulated the expression of the fusion proteins mitofusin1,mitofusin2,and optic atrophy 1(closely related to mitochondrial quality remodeling),and reduced the expression of the fission protein dynamicrelated protein 1,as well as mitochondrial fission protein 1.Conclusion:The mechanism by which BYQZF increased the mitochondrial protective effect of Parkin gene overexpression in MPPþ-induced cells may be related to improving mitochondrial function and regulating the balance of mitochondrial division and fusion proteins.Cuicui Cheng Yushan Gao Cong Gai Wandi Feng Haojie Ma Jing Feng Zhenyu Guo Shujing Zhang Jie Wu Hongmei Sun 2022Journal of Traditional Chinese Medical Sciences2022,9,1:0
4Effects of stress of different duration on depression-like behavior and expression of CB1 and GluA1 in medial prefrontal cortex of rats显示文摘Objective:To explore the changes of cannabinoid receptor(CB1)and AMPA receptor subunit GluA1 in the medial prefrontal cortex(mPFC)of depression model rats induced by chronic unpredictable mild stress(CUMS).Methods:30 rats were randomly divided into three groups.The three-week model group was given a three-week CUMS model,the four-week model group was given a four-week CUMS model,and the control group was given no treatment.The behavior of rats were detected in each group,and the expression of CB1 and GluA1 protein in synaptosomes in mPFC brain region was detected by Western blot.Results:Compared with the control group,the surcose preference decreased,the feeding latency increased in the novel inhibition feeding test,and the immobility time increased in the forced swimming test in the four-week model group.However,after three weeks of CUMS,there was no obvious change in the behavior of rats compared with the control group,suggesting that four-week model of CUMS was successful.CUMS can reduce the expression level of CB1 and GluA1 protein in synaptosomes of mPFC brain area in four-week model group(P<0.05),but there was no significant difference between three-week model group and control group.Conclusion:Four-week CUMS was more likely to lead to depressive-like behavior in rats,which may be closely related to the expression of CB1 and GluA1 in mPFC.Yu-Xin Zhang Hong-Mei Sun Cong Gai Cui-Cui Cheng Lu-Ping Yang Zhen-Yu Guo Yu-Shan Gao Die Hu 2022Journal of Hainan Medical University2022,28,10:0
5The construction of OPA1 overexpression plasmid and the cell model显示文摘The purpose of this study is to construct OPA1 overexpression plasmid and transfected into human neuroblastoma SH-SY5Y cells to test the overexpression efficiency.Human neuroblastoma SH SY5Y cells were transfected with the OPA1 overexpression plasmid by Lipo3000 transfection reagent in liposome transduction technology.A total of 3 groups were set up:the control group,negative control group,and OPA1 overexpression model group.RT-PCR technique was used to detect the expression of OPA1 at mRNA level.In addition,Western blot technique was used to detect the expression of OPA1 at protein level.We found that the mRNA and protein expression of OPA1 were significantly increased after transfection with OPA1 overexpression plasmid.These results highlight using liposome transduction technology,the OPA1 overexpression plasmid was successfully transfected into SH-SY5Y cells by Lipo3000 and the cell model of OPA1 gene overexpression was successully established.Ma Haojie Gai Cong Feng Wandi Cheng Cuicui Zhou Mengqi Zhang Jinkun Zhang Yuxin Yang Luping Guo Zhenyu Sun Hongmei 2021解剖学杂志2021,44,S01:0

11Expression of PNNs and the functional changes of GABA-ergic neurons in the medial prefrontal cortex in a rat model of depression显示文摘Objective:To investigate the effects of chronic unpredictable mild stress(CUMS)on perineuronal nets(PNNs)andγ-aminobutyric acid(GABA)-ergic neurons in the medial prefrontal cortex(mPFC)of adult rats.Methods:28 rats were randomly divided into two groups.The model group adopted CUMS to establish a depression model,and the control group did not give any treatment.The density of PNNs and the percentage of PNNs positive(PNNs^(+))and parvalbumin positive(PV^(+))neurons in total PV^(+)neurons in the mPFC were detected by immunofluorescence.The protein expression of main components of PNNs,Aggrecan and Brevican,and GABA main synthase glutamic acid decarboxylase 67(GAD67)in the mPFC were detected by Western blot.Results:The density of PNNs and the percentage of PNNs^(+)and PV^(+)neurons in total PV^(+)neurons in the mPFC in the model group were decreased compared with the control group(P<0.05);The expression levels of PNNs component proteins Aggrecan and Brevican,and GABA main synthase GAD67 were also decreased in the model group(P<0.01).Conclusion:The levels of PNNs and GABA synthase GAD67 in the mPFC of rats were decreased after chronic unpredictable mild stress.Yu-Xin Zhang Cong Gai Hao-Jie Ma Cui-Cui Cheng Jin-Kun Zhang Lu-Ping Yang Wan-Di Feng Meng-Qi Zhou Hai-Hong Zhao Die Hu Hong-Mei Sun 2021Journal of Hainan Medical University2021,27,4:0
